Origin of rebounds with a restitution coefficient larger than unity in nanocluster collisions (1208.0130v3)
Published 1 Aug 2012 in cond-mat.mes-hall
Abstract: We numerically investigate the mechanism of super rebounds for head-on collisions between nanoclusters in which the restitution coefficient is larger than unity. It is confirmed that the temperature and the entropy of the nanocluters decrease after the super rebounds by our molecular dynamics simulations. It is also found that the initial metastable structure plays a key role for the emergence of the super rebounds.
